WebFeb 16, 2005 · Doughy skin; Skin turgor; Good skin turgor; Decreased skin turgor. Definition Skin turgor is an abnormality in the skin’s ability to change shape and return to normal (elasticity). Skin turgor is the skin’s degree of resistance to deformation and is determined by various factors, such as the amount of fluids in the body (hydration) and age. WebTurgor pressure pushes the plasma membrane against the cell wall of plant, bacteria, and fungi cells as well as those protist cells which have cell walls. This pressure, turgidity, is caused by the osmotic flow of water from area of low solute concentration outside of the cell into the cell's vacuole, which has a higher solute concentration.Healthy plant cells are …
WebApr 4, 2024 · The central vacuole is a large vacuole found inside of plant cells. A vacuole is a sphere filled with fluid and molecules inside a cell. The central vacuole stores water and maintains turgor pressure in a plant cell. It also pushes the contents of the cell toward the cell membrane, which allows the plant cells to take in more light energy for ...
